Special Education Teachers, Secondary School Salary in Washington

Median Annual Salary $97,820 +41% above national average (national: $69,590)
$93,300Mean Annual
N/AMedian Hourly
2,470Employed in State

Washington ranks 2nd of 51 states and D.C. for special education teachers, secondary school pay, trailing top-paying California ($101,250) by $3,430 — a 4% gap.

Special Education Teachers, Secondary School are less concentrated in Washington than the U.S. average — a location quotient of 0.66 means the occupation's share of local jobs is 1.52× below the national share.

Washington employs roughly 1.5% of all special education teachers, secondary school in the country (2,470 workers).

Full Percentile Breakdown

PercentileAnnual WageHourly Wage
10th percentile (entry-level)$62,430N/A
25th percentile$78,230N/A
50th percentile (median)$97,820N/A
75th percentile$107,130N/A
90th percentile (top earners)$122,700N/A
Mean (average)$93,300N/A

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average Special Education Teachers, Secondary School salary in Washington?

The mean special education teachers, secondary school salary in Washington is $93,300 per year. The median (middle) salary is $97,820 per year.

What is the starting salary for a Special Education Teachers, Secondary School in Washington?

Entry-level special education teachers, secondary schools (10th percentile) in Washington typically earn around $62,430 per year. Workers at the 25th percentile earn approximately $78,230 per year.

What is the highest Special Education Teachers, Secondary School salary in Washington?

Top earners (90th percentile) in this occupation in Washington make approximately $122,700 per year. Those in the 75th percentile earn around $107,130 per year.

How does the Washington Special Education Teachers, Secondary School salary compare to the national average?

The median special education teachers, secondary school salary in Washington is $97,820, which is +41% above national average of $69,590.
